Sehuri

Sehuri is a village located in Shohratgarh tehsil of Siddharthnagar district in Uttar Pradesh, India. It is situated 10km away from sub-district headquarter Shohratgarh (tehsildar office) and 15km away from district headquarter Siddharthnagar. As per 2009 stats, Sehura is the gram panchayat of Sehuri village.

About Sehuri

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Sehuri is 176314. The village spans a total geographical area of 46.99 hectares. Shohratgarh is nearest town to Sehuri village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 10km away.

Population of Sehuri

Below is a concise population overview of Sehuri as per the Census 2011 data. The table highlights the key population metrics categorized by gender and social groups.

ParticularsTotalMaleFemale
Total Population 523 270 253
Child Population (0–6 yrs) 70 37 33
Scheduled Castes (SC) 151 70 81
Scheduled Tribes (ST) N/A N/A N/A
Literate Population 268 155 113
Illiterate Population 255 115 140

Here's a detailed summary of the Basic Population Details of Sehuri village:

  • The total population of Sehuri village is around 523, including approximately 270 males and 253 females, with a sex ratio of 937 females per 1,000 males.
  • There are about 70 children aged 0–6 years in Sehuri village, reflecting the young population in the village.
  • Sehuri village has 151 people belonging to the Scheduled Castes (SC).
  • The literacy rate of Sehuri village is about 51.24%, with male literacy at 57.41% and female literacy at 44.66%.
  • There are around 77 households in Sehuri village.

Connectivity of Sehuri

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Sehuri. As per the 2011 stats, Sehuri had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.

Connectivity Type Status (in year 2011)
Public Bus Service Available within 5 - 10 km distance
Private Bus Service Available within 5 - 10 km distance
Railway Station Available within 5 - 10 km distance
